For a Lorentzian manifold compactness implies disturbance of causality. The present paper supports this general expectation by exact theorems. A Lorentzian manifold \((M,g)\) here is assumed to be \(C^\infty\), connected, and time-oriented. Every compact \((M,g)\) which admits a time-like conformal Killing vector field is shown to be totally vicious, i.e., the past and the future of any point is the whole of \(M\). Every compact \((M,g)\) conformal to a static spacetime is geodesically connected by causal geodesics and admits a time-like closed geodesic.
